Output 50a7a977494aaaf20e7b02e5db9af1c5cc57ef8cb7c757dde84de899578eb6b6:6

value
90500250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ac584704004008bec971eee98cfdeb626b1c7e OP_EQUAL
address
393aScs6njkjXC5szsBXvTWTFicgNFmePd
transaction
50a7a977494aaaf20e7b02e5db9af1c5cc57ef8cb7c757dde84de899578eb6b6
spent
true